Transaction 08710b51d9a5a9223a84e9496db90d228436368e2010901e670f64fd257665e8
1 Input
2 Outputs
- 08710b51d9a5a9223a84e9496db90d228436368e2010901e670f64fd257665e8:0
- 08710b51d9a5a9223a84e9496db90d228436368e2010901e670f64fd257665e8:1
value 32969506
address 3G8yWLcKEphb3xigyo6jRA1MVB7QQq7VyC
value 38912120626
address 15tYFmUV6wG4e1Gbi1buxBM9zSQzcWSkiK